Natalie Fairbourne

Co-Founder and CPO at Yoodlize

Natalie Fairbourne has a diverse work experience spanning several companies and roles. In 2000, they worked as a Field Researcher at CHOICE for six months. From 2009 to 2013, they owned and operated Hobble Creek Kitchen. In 2013, Natalie joined Motiis as a Business Development professional, where they analyzed the financial viability of opportunities and created systems for accounting and auditing practices. Natalie also worked as a Senior Finance Manager at Bamba Water, where they developed accounting and cash flow management systems. In 2015, Natalie co-founded Bestway Supermarket Mtaani, a mini supermarket chain in Mombasa. Natalie served as a Co-founder and sought funding for scaling the venture across Kenya. In 2018, Natalie founded Bee's Kitchen, a full food service that managed kitchens and provided menu planning and inventory management. Currently, they are a Co-Founder and CPO at Yoodlize, an online peer-to-peer marketplace app, where they oversee product design, operations, and customer support.

Natalie Fairbourne attended Brigham Young University from 1997 to 2001, where they studied English Language and Literature/Letters. In 2022, they enrolled in the University of Utah Professional Education Boot Camps for full stack development. Furthermore, Natalie obtained a Coding Bootcamp Full Stack Developer Certificate from the University of Utah in November 2022.
